The 10 Ways To Live A Practical Life
To follow God’s plan and guidance in life,
we must make our lives practical and consistent with Bible principles. All of these 10 Bible-based ways of living will help us achieve a deeper relationship with God and proper progress in society.
1. Have daily communication with God (prayer) 🙏
Prayer is a personal and deep conversation with God. These conversations give us peace and guidance in facing the challenges of our lives. The Bible says in Matthew 6:9, “Pray like this: Our Father in heaven, hallowed be your name.” When we pray, we can share our feelings and thoughts with God.
Practical example:
If you are facing a problem at work or in your personal life, prayer can bring you a deep sense of peace. You know that when you talk to God, He is listening to your concerns and will guide you.
2. Studying the Bible (to understand universal truth) 📖
We need Bible study to gain an understanding of God’s purpose and the right path for our lives. Isaiah 55:11 says, “My words will return to me and accomplish the work for which I sent them.”
Practical example:
Studying the Bible gives us clear knowledge about all aspects of life. When you have to make a certain decision, the teachings of the Bible can guide you to make the right decision. As James 1:5 says, “If any of you lacks wisdom, God, in his mercy, will give it to all.”
3. Focus on service and charity (working for the good of society) ❤️
God’s love motivates us to serve others and make a positive difference in their lives. The Bible says in John 13:34, “Love one another as I have loved you.” Service should be in action, not just in words.
Practical example:
When you spend time in an orphanage or feed the poor, you are doing an act of love and service to God. Such acts bring deep satisfaction and peace to your life.
4. Tell the truth and be honest (be true to your word) 🗣️
Speaking the truth is a commandment of God. It is an important aspect of our living a life of honesty and truth. Ephesians 4:25 says, “Let us not lie, but speak the truth.”
Practical example:
If you speak the truth in your office or at home, your faith and honesty will be proven. This will give you deep peace and a stronger relationship with God.
5. Have an attitude of forgiveness and forgiveness (giving a second chance) 💔
God has forgiven us and is asking us to forgive others. Matthew 6:14 says, “If you forgive others, your heavenly Father will also forgive you.”
Practical example:
When your friend hurts you, you try to forgive. This gives you peace and spiritual health and brings God’s love into your life.
6. Patience and fortitude (remaining calm in adverse situations) ⏳
Patience and endurance are important qualities in our lives. When we are patient, we receive God’s guidance and our faith is strengthened. Romans 12:12 says, “Endure everything with patience, and be steadfast in faith.”
Practical example:
When difficulties come into your life, you must patiently trust in God’s plan. Your patience will ultimately bring you success and peace.
7. Self-evaluation (meditation for spiritual progress and refinement) 🔍
Self-evaluation gives us a true picture of our spiritual condition. 2 Corinthians 13:5 says, “Examine yourselves to see whether you are in the faith.”
Practical example:
At the end of the day, you review your thoughts and actions. Did you follow God’s guidance in everything? This will help you grow spiritually.
8. Have hope and faith (have faith in God’s plan) 🌟
Amidst the difficulties and worries of our lives, it is important to have faith in God’s plan. Jeremiah 29:11 says, “I have prepared a plan for you, a plan for your future and a hope.”
Practical example:
When you worry about your future, trust in Jeremiah 29:11. God’s plan is always good for you.
